The Unique Design of Beaver Scalpel Blades
Beaver scalpel blades stand out due to their specialized design, which prioritizes precision. Unlike traditional surgical blades, they are smaller, more refined, and specifically engineered for fine surgical work. These blades are typically attached to Beaver handles, which offer improved control and stability. The combination of a sharp cutting edge and a well-balanced handle enables surgeons to perform delicate procedures with minimal tissue trauma.
Manufactured from high-quality stainless steel, Beaver blades maintain their sharpness for extended periods, reducing the need for frequent replacements. Many of these blades also come with specialty coatings to enhance their cutting efficiency and reduce friction during incisions. Their fine, razor-like edges ensure clean, precise cuts, which is essential in surgeries requiring extreme accuracy, such as ophthalmic and microvascular procedures.
Applications in Various Surgical Fields
One of the defining characteristics of Beaver scalpel blades is their widespread use across multiple surgical disciplines. They are particularly popular in ophthalmology, where precision is paramount for delicate procedures such as corneal transplants and cataract surgeries. The ultra-sharp edges allow for controlled incisions in sensitive areas, reducing the risk of unnecessary tissue damage.
In plastic and reconstructive surgery, Beaver blades play a vital role in achieving aesthetically pleasing results. Surgeons rely on their fine cutting ability to make precise incisions that heal with minimal scarring. Whether performing a delicate skin graft or intricate facial surgery, the precision of these blades ensures optimal results.
Microvascular and neurosurgical procedures also benefit from the refined design of Beaver blades. When working with small blood vessels and nerves, even the slightest inaccuracy can have significant consequences. The ultra-thin blades provide the control and sharpness required to navigate complex surgical sites with confidence.
Advantages Over Traditional Scalpel Blades
Compared to conventional scalpel blades, Beaver blades offer several advantages that make them indispensable for certain procedures. Their smaller size allows for enhanced maneuverability, which is particularly useful in surgeries requiring high levels of dexterity. The sharpness and durability of the blades also contribute to cleaner incisions, reducing tissue trauma and promoting faster healing.
Another benefit is their compatibility with specialized handles that enhance grip and control. Surgeons can choose from a variety of handle designs, ensuring they have the best possible instrument for their specific needs. This adaptability makes Beaver scalpel blades a go-to choice for many professionals seeking precision and reliability.
